Donald Garibaldi Obituary

Donald Garibaldi
08/07/1932 - 02/28/2025
Donald Joseph Garibaldi, son of Joseph and Ida Garibaldi, husband of 65 years to wife Carolyn, father of Lisa and David, father-in-law to Bob Armanini and Michele Koshaba-Garibaldi, brother of Irene Aubright and brother -in-law to Harry Aubright, Arline Del Grande and Doreen Bertani, and uncle to many nieces and a nephew, and a large extended family, passed away peacefully surrounded by his family on February 28, 2025 and was laid to rest on March 11, 2025, at Holy Cross Cemetary. A resident of Daly City and a member of the farming community of San Mateo County for approximately 75 years, Don will be remembered for his infectious personality and his passion for farming and growing of award winning cut flowers at both Garden Valley Nursery in Colma and 45 years in his family-owned business, Ano Nuevo Flower Growers. Don attended Serra High School in San Mateo and graduated in 1951. He was on the football team at Serra where he developed such a passion for college and professional football, namely the Notre Dame Fighting Irish and the San Francisco 49ers. Don served his country in the US Navy during the Korean War. He had a heart as big as the moon and would never shy away from extending his hand out to help those less fortunate than him. His love for his family was unmatchable as he always said, "Family First." He will be surely missed by those that knew and loved him.
